Implementation notes: amd64, h9ivy, crypto_sign/ronald4096

Computer: h9ivy
Architecture: amd64
CPU ID: GenuineIntel-000306a9-bfebfbff
SUPERCOP version: 20141014
Operation: crypto_sign
Primitive: ronald4096
TimeImplementationCompilerBenchmark dateSUPERCOP version
34541004opensslgcc -funroll-loops -Os -fomit-frame-pointer2014070820140622
34545908opensslg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2014070820140622
34550368opensslg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2014070820140622
34552784opensslgcc -m64 -march=core2 -O2 -fomit-frame-pointer2014070820140622
34555916opensslgcc -m64 -march=corei7-avx -O3 -fomit-frame-pointer2014070820140622
34556864opensslgcc -O2 -fomit-frame-pointer2014070820140622
34558100opensslgc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er2014070820140622
34558164opensslgcc -m64 -march=core2 -O3 -fomit-frame-pointer2014070820140622
34558752opensslgcc -m64 -march=corei7-avx -O2 -fomit-frame-pointer2014070820140622
34559400opensslgcc -m64 -march=core-avx-i -O3 -fomit-frame-pointer2014070820140622
34560688opensslgc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er2014070820140622
34561160opensslgcc -m64 -O3 -fomit-frame-pointer2014070820140622
34562388opensslg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2014070820140622
34563932opensslgcc -m64 -march=core-avx-i -Os -fomit-frame-pointer2014070820140622
34564148opensslg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2014070820140622
34564256opensslgc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er2014070820140622
34565424opensslgc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er2014070820140622
34565940opensslgc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er2014070820140622
34567180opensslg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2014070820140622
34567332opensslgcc -march=nocona -O2 -fomit-frame-pointer2014070820140622
34567464opensslgcc -fno-schedule-insns -O -fomit-frame-pointer2014070820140622
34568120opensslgcc -funroll-loops -O3 -fomit-frame-pointer2014070820140622
34568196opensslgc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er2014070820140622
34569376opensslg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2014070820140622
34569792opensslgcc -m64 -march=core-avx-i -O -fomit-frame-pointer2014070820140622
34570972opensslg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2014070820140622
34572880opensslg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2014070820140622
34573236opensslgcc -O3 -fomit-frame-pointer2014070820140622
34573740opensslgcc -m64 -march=nocona -O3 -fomit-frame-pointer2014070820140622
34574116opensslgcc -funroll-loops2014070820140622
34577012opensslgcc -m64 -march=k8 -Os -fomit-frame-pointer2014070820140622
34577952opensslgcc -m64 -march=barcelona -O -fomit-frame-pointer2014070820140622
34578352opensslgc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er2014070820140622
34579104opensslgcc -march=nocona -Os -fomit-frame-pointer2014070820140622
34579384opensslgcc -march=barcelona -O -fomit-frame-pointer2014070820140622
34580600opensslg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2014070820140622
34580716opensslgcc -march=barcelona -Os -fomit-frame-pointer2014070820140622
34581116opensslgc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er2014070820140622
34581376opensslgcc -m64 -march=native -mtune=native -O -fomit-frame-pointer2014070820140622
34581936opensslgcc -march=k8 -O3 -fomit-frame-pointer2014070820140622
34582592opensslgcc -march=barcelona -O2 -fomit-frame-pointer2014070820140622
34583484opensslgcc -m64 -march=corei7-avx -Os -fomit-frame-pointer2014070820140622
34583524opensslg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2014070820140622
34583620opensslgcc -funroll-loops -O2 -fomit-frame-pointer2014070820140622
34584176opensslgcc -m64 -O2 -fomit-frame-pointer2014070820140622
34584184opensslg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2014070820140622
34584972opensslg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2014070820140622
34587020opensslgcc -m64 -march=k8 -O2 -fomit-frame-pointer2014070820140622
34587948opensslgcc -m64 -march=nocona -Os -fomit-frame-pointer2014070820140622
34588216opensslg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2014070820140622
34588592opensslgc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er2014070820140622
34589292opensslgc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er2014070820140622
34590120opensslgcc -m64 -O -fomit-frame-pointer2014070820140622
34590156opensslgc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er2014070820140622
34591344opensslgcc -march=nocona -O -fomit-frame-pointer2014070820140622
34591436opensslgcc -m64 -march=nocona -O -fomit-frame-pointer2014070820140622
34591512opensslgcc -m64 -march=barcelona -Os -fomit-frame-pointer2014070820140622
34591824opensslgcc -m64 -march=core-avx-i -O2 -fomit-frame-pointer2014070820140622
34592164opensslgcc -march=k8 -O2 -fomit-frame-pointer2014070820140622
34592332opensslgcc -m64 -march=nocona -O2 -fomit-frame-pointer2014070820140622
34592420opensslgcc -m64 -march=corei7 -O3 -fomit-frame-pointer2014070820140622
34592628opensslg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2014070820140622
34592808opensslgc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er2014070820140622
34593912opensslgcc -march=k8 -O -fomit-frame-pointer2014070820140622
34594660opensslgcc -march=nocona -O3 -fomit-frame-pointer2014070820140622
34595620opensslgcc -funroll-loops -O -fomit-frame-pointer2014070820140622
34596716opensslcc2014070820140622
34597112opensslgcc -fno-schedule-insns -O3 -fomit-frame-pointer2014070820140622
34597856opensslgcc -funroll-loops -m64 -Os -fomit-frame-pointer2014070820140622
34598144opensslg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2014070820140622
34600260opensslgcc -m64 -Os -fomit-frame-pointer2014070820140622
34601820opensslgc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er2014070820140622
34602860opensslgcc -march=barcelona -O3 -fomit-frame-pointer2014070820140622
34603732opensslgcc -m64 -march=k8 -O3 -fomit-frame-pointer2014070820140622
34603916opensslgcc -m64 -march=corei7 -O2 -fomit-frame-pointer2014070820140622
34604052opensslgc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er2014070820140622
34604568opensslgc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er2014070820140622
34604628opensslgcc -fno-schedule-insns -Os -fomit-frame-pointer2014070820140622
34605156opensslg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2014070820140622
34605792opensslgcc -m64 -march=corei7-avx -O -fomit-frame-pointer2014070820140622
34607068opensslg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2014070820140622
34607908opensslg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2014070820140622
34609176opensslgcc -m64 -march=corei7 -O -fomit-frame-pointer2014070820140622
34609452opensslgcc -Os -fomit-frame-pointer2014070820140622
34610840opensslgc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er2014070820140622
34611220opensslgcc -O -fomit-frame-pointer2014070820140622
34612208opensslgcc -funroll-loops -march=barcelona -O -fomit-frame-pointer2014070820140622
34612812opensslg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2014070820140622
34613176opensslg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2014070820140622
34613768opensslgcc -m64 -march=corei7 -Os -fomit-frame-pointer2014070820140622
34613996opensslgcc -fno-schedule-insns -O2 -fomit-frame-pointer2014070820140622
34617844opensslgc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er2014070820140622
34618212opensslgcc2014070820140622
34618564opensslgcc -m64 -march=k8 -O -fomit-frame-pointer2014070820140622
34620940opensslg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2014070820140622
34621460opensslg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2014070820140622
34623636opensslgc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er2014070820140622
34645636opensslgcc -march=k8 -Os -fomit-frame-pointer2014070820140622
34662260opensslgcc -funroll-loops -m64 -O -fomit-frame-pointer2014070820140622
34693304opensslg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2014070820140622
34698524opensslgcc -m64 -march=core2 -O -fomit-frame-pointer2014070820140622
34789936opensslgcc -m64 -march=core2 -Os -fomit-frame-pointer2014070820140622
34889500opensslg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2014070820140622